#82689e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#82689e is composed of 51% red, 40.8%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 268.9 degrees, a saturation of 21.8% and a lightness of 51.4%. #82689e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#05003d.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#82689e color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.

#82689e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#82689e has RGB values of R:130, G:104,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 8546462.

Shades and Tints of #82689e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030304 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#82689e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837b8b is the less saturated color, while #7e09fd is the most saturated one.
